The Eddy County is a county in the state of North Dakota of the United States . The county seat is New Rockford .

geography

The county is located northeast of the geographic center of North Dakota and has an area of ​​1,889 square kilometers, of which 37 square kilometers are water. It is bordered clockwise by the following counties: Benson County , Nelson County , Griggs County , Foster County, and Wells County .

history

Eddy County was formed on March 31, 1885. It was named after Ezra B. Eddy, one of the first bankers in the Fargo area .

Five buildings and sites in the county are listed on the National Register of Historic Places (as of March 22, 2018).

As of the 2000 census , Eddy County had 2,757 people in 1,164 households and 743 families. The population density was 2 people per square kilometer. The racial the population was composed of 96.37 percent white, 0.07 percent African American, 2.36 percent Native American, 0.15 percent Asian, 0.07 percent of residents from the Pacific island area and 0.25 percent from other ethnic groups Groups; 0.73 percent were descended from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race was 0.62 percent of the population.

Of the 1,164 households, 27.7 percent had children and adolescents under the age of 18 living with them. 56.4 percent were married couples living together, 5.0 percent were single mothers, 36.1 percent were non-families, 34.2 percent were single households, and 20.4 percent had people aged 65 years or over. The average household size was 2.30 and the average family size was 2.96 people.

For the entire county, the population was composed of 23.6 percent of residents under 18 years of age, 6.1 percent between 18 and 24 years of age, 22.5 percent between 25 and 44 years of age, and 23.1 percent between 45 and 64 years of age 24.7 percent were 65 years of age or over. The median age was 44 years. For every 100 females there were 95.5 males. For every 100 women aged 18 or over there were statistically 92.3 men.

The median income for a household in the 28,642 USD , and the median income for a family was 37,625 USD. Males had a median income of $ 24,063 versus $ 20,344 for females. The per capita income was $ 15,941. 6.9 percent of families and 9.7 percent families lived below the poverty line. Of these, 11.5 percent were children or adolescents under the age of 18 and 11.0 percent were people over 65 years of age.
